Output 5cfec33d2cafa8d0e2df70a25dae659eea4d64ebdb138d1f073be1b25c23b3ac:31

value
1231235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cb9c0971d6b9e607feba70a2e413afff71846c9 OP_EQUAL
address
37E6zMFpkFcM2LwrFcivRvoUj3fLG9EnRv
transaction
5cfec33d2cafa8d0e2df70a25dae659eea4d64ebdb138d1f073be1b25c23b3ac
confirmations
221334
spent
true